Learning Tree International Announces First Quarter 2017 Results

Learning Tree International, Inc. (OTCQX: LTRE) announced today its revenues and results of operations for its first quarter 2017, which ended December 30, 2016.

In its first quarter of fiscal year 2017, Learning Tree reported revenues of $18.6 million, loss from operations before income taxes of $0.3 million, and a net loss of $0.4 million, or $(0.03) per share. These results compare with revenues of $20.1 million, loss from operations before income taxes of $2.2 million, and net loss of $2.3 million, or $(0.17) per share, in Learning Tree’s first quarter of fiscal year 2016. The 7.8% decline in revenues for our first quarter of fiscal year 2017 when compared to the first quarter of fiscal year 2016, was partially offset by a 10.7% reduction in cost of revenues and a 19.7% reduction in total operating expenses. As a result, our first quarter loss from operations was $0.5 million as compared to $2.3 million for the first quarter of fiscal year 2016.

Our liquidity and working capital needs have historically been funded through our cash and cash equivalents. At December 30, 2016, our capital resources consisted of cash and cash equivalents of $7.2 million. As previously announced, on January 12, 2017, we entered into a financing and security agreement with Action Capital Corporation (“Action Capital”) that provides us with access to borrow through advances of funds up to a maximum aggregate principal amount of $3.0 million. While we have and continue to take steps to stabilize revenues and decrease our operating costs and entered into the financing transaction with Action Capital, unless we are able to further improve our liquidity in the future, there is substantial doubt about our ability to continue as a going concern. Our registered independent public accounting firm’s report on our audited financial statements for the year ended September 30, 2016 that are included as part of our annual report on Form 10-K that was fil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ission contains an explanatory paragraph related to our ability to continue as a going concern. We are continuing to work to further improve our liquidity position and are evaluating additional sources of capital and financing. However, there is no assurance that additional capital and/or financing will be available to us, and even if available, whether it will be on terms acceptable to us or in amounts required.

About Learning Tree International, Inc.

Established in 1974, Learning Tree is a leading provider of IT training to business and government organizations worldwide. Learning Tree provides Workforce Optimization Solutions — a modern approach to delivering learning and development services that improves the adoption of skills, and accelerates the implementation of technical and business processes required to improve IT service delivery. These services include: needs assessments, skill gaps analyses, blended learning solutions, and Project Acceleration Workshops.

Over 2.4 million professionals have enhanced their skills through Learning Tree’s extensive library of proprietary and partner content on topics including: web development, cyber security, program and project management, Agile, operating systems, networking, cloud computing, leadership, and more.
